Cool Octavia WRC alloy wheels

I don't know whether this should be in the tuning, styling, motorsport section instead

Anyway - can anybody tell me which alloy wheels were fitted to the WRC Octavia (the one set up for fast tarmac stages). They look similar to the ones fitted to the Octy vRS and I think are made by 'OZ Racing'.

The Octavia WRC has Speedline Corse fitted for tarmac stages. They are 18's. You can buy them from Demon Tweeks and the like, about Ł900 for the set. Come in white and silver.

There Speedline Turini's 18x8, Most wheel retailers will do them with tyres for 1200. I wanted some for ages.
